Blanche Aigle Communications Triumphs at SABRE Awards Africa 2024

Blanche Aigle Communications, a leading public relations and communications firm based in Lagos, Nigeria, has been honored with the prestigious SABRE Awards for its outstanding work on the Hilda Baci Cookathon campaign.

The firm received Superior Achievement in Brand Building in the Diamond category, Best Campaign Western Africa region – Gold, and a Certificate of Excellence for Best in Show.

Blanche Aigle played a crucial role in the campaign’s success by developing and executing a comprehensive communication strategy. This strategy included public relations, media relations, influencer partnerships, and event coordination support, resulting in significant media coverage and global audience engagement.

The cookathon event, held in Lagos in 2023, attracted thousands of attendees and virtual supporters, fostering a sense of community and shared purpose. It successfully set a new Guinness World Record for cooking for 93 hours and 11 minutes.

Nene also spoke at the SABRE Awards conference in Ivory Coast on May 16, where she was a panelist alongside other public relations professionals from across the continent. 

The panel, moderated by Arun Sudhaman, CEO and Editor-in-Chief at PRovoke Media, included notable panelists such as Dustin Chick from Razor PR, Mike Sharman from Retroviral, Moliehi Molekoa from Magna Carta, and Sergio from Clockwork Media.

The discussion highlighted outstanding campaigns from all African regions, with Blanche Aigle Communications representing West Africa. The Hilda Baci Cookathon campaign garnered extensive media attention from top-tier outlets such as CNN, BBC, DW, and AFP, bringing international recognition to Nigerian cuisine. This accolade celebrates outstanding achievements in strategic communication and public relations in Africa, highlighting creativity, integrity, and effectiveness in the industry.

Over the years, Blanche Aigle has worked with various corporate and global brands, including GB Foods, Henley and Partners, Baigewallet, Aspira, African Film Festival (ARIFF), Mango, and Celio. In 2022, the firm received a Certificate of Excellence for the Mango Yuletide campaign at the SABRE Awards.
